Choosing a Double Glazing Window Handle

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gWindow handles are available in a variety of styles. They are typically uPVC but can be aluminium or wood. They can be cockspurs key locking, or cranked.

Espagnolette handles are the most well-known kind of uPVC window handle. They have a square spindle in the back that is connected to the gear box of the lock inside the window frame.

You can pick from various window handles for double-glazed windows made of timber. The choice of handles will depend on the type of window. Tilt and turn handles for example, are used on windows that open to the inside by using side hinges. They can also be tilted" to let air in from the outside. These types of handles have an elongated spindle bar at the back that enters into a gear box. It can be locked to prevent the sash from moving but still allowing you to tilt the window. Espag handles are found on a variety of new uPVC windows. They work similarly to cockspur handles, but with a lower step height.

Cockspur handles are characterized by an "nose" or arm that closes by an attachment to the frame. They are usually found on older uPVC and wooden casement windows. They can be fitted with the standard latch door lock handle repair and wedge or more secure multi-point locking systems, especially for high-security applications.

Modern wedge fasteners are commonly used on uPVC windows that are more modern. They are often supplied as key locks to meet insurance requirements.
